Description: As a Program/Project/Management Analyst, you will coordinate with other members of the PMA customer supporting a Navy program at Naval Air Station Patuxent River (Pax).

Responsibilities
  • Coordinate, attend, and participate in IPT and prime contractor meetings, program review meetings, requirements reviews, design reviews, and other meetings as required.
  • Obtain and disseminate weekly status reports on fielding and deployments to both government and industry.
  • Support planning activities to include presenting alternative funding or acquisition strategies and cost estimates for program requirements. Enter planning data in the Common Spend Plan Tool (CSPT), AHMS, Acquisition Matrix (AcqMat), PMT or appropriate tool.
  • Track program progress and status of vendor critical contract deadlines to identify and report potential problems or issues with schedule conflicts, resource scarcity, and proposed solutions.
  • Collect and perform analysis on Earned Value Management (EVM) data and program documentation received from suppliers. Track cost, schedule, and performance indicators, critical path review, and risk analysis.
  • Provide recommendations for Total Ownership Cost (TOC), Should Cost, Cost as an Independent Variable (CAIV) and Life Cycle Cost (LCC) evaluations.
  • Perform cost/benefit analyses, cost trade-off analyses, business case analyses, cost variance analyses, and/or present value analyses to support the programs in balancing mission requirements, system constraints, performance, and provide technical input for acquisition documentation.
  • Provide recommendations and alternatives in support of program execution, spend plan development, out-year planning, and the creation of POM issue sheets as related to the Planning, Program, Budgeting, Execution (PPBE) process.
